Summary:
The 89406 zip code is home to a single high school, Churchill County High School, which serves grades 9-12. The school's performance and characteristics suggest it is facing significant challenges in academic achievement, student engagement, and resource allocation.
Churchill County High School has an enrollment of 1,089 students and is ranked 10 out of 12 high schools in the state of Nevada, with a 1-star rating from SchoolDigger. The school's four-year graduation rate is 81.6%, and it has a concerning 26.6% chronic absenteeism rate. Academically, the school's test scores in science, math, and English are well below the state averages, indicating that students are struggling to meet proficiency standards.
Despite the school's relatively high spending of $10,072 per student, the student-teacher ratio of 27.2 to 1 suggests a need for more teachers or smaller class sizes to better support student learning. Additionally, the school's 100% free/reduced lunch rate indicates a high level of poverty among the student population, which may be contributing to the low academic performance and high absenteeism. Overall, the data suggests that Churchill County High School requires targeted interventions and support to improve student outcomes.
